Violations are broken into two categories: Foodborne Illness Risk Factors: These are the types of violations that can make someone ill if they are not corrected. Food You can also access the Business Perry Supervisor Good Retail Practices: These violations are also important for protecting public health, but have less potential to cause a significant foodborne illness. Division Manager The goal of the Food Safety Programs enforcement guide is to have and maintain a progressive enforcement approach that includes outreach and education which ultimately ensures each facility is in compliance with the Ohio Uniform Food Code.
